Output 958443ab9bf75c3823bf00b82c1b6a4e9698d435173f8a4ab26ec5a0f083c1bf:31

value
67063
script pubkey
OP_0 OP_PUSHBYTES_20 4341c062dc47a5b642260c774e05ecce115889bb
address
bc1qgdquqckug7jmvs3xp3m5up0vecg43zdmszhgs5
transaction
958443ab9bf75c3823bf00b82c1b6a4e9698d435173f8a4ab26ec5a0f083c1bf
confirmations
6185
spent
true